Adventure Express/Arrow Mine Trains

Featured Replies

This is an interesting fact.    Out of the 16 mine trains built by arrow since 1966, all are still operating except Dexter Frebish Electric Roller Ride/Excalibur at Astroworld.  And that coaster was removed to be replaced by an SLC, not because of ride age or mechanical issues.

AE appears that it will have a VERY long life if the park chooses.

They are relatively low maintenance rides. The trains don't experience any extreme speed or hard g forces. They should last a long time plus due to the slower speed it doesn't feel as rough. Plus they are good family coasters and fill a good spot in almost any park line up.
